Stacked Deck from Riftbound TCG

Stacked Deck is what consistency looks like when it throws on a velvet blazer and saunters into a high-stakes brawl.

For 1 mana, this spell is one of the cleanest pieces of dig-and-filter Riftbound’s revealed so far.

Whether you’re smoothing out your opener or hunting down a game-ending play mid-combat, Stacked Deck doesn’t waste your time or tempo.

It’s flexible, lean, and fits into nearly every strategy that doesn’t want to risk topdeck RNG when the stakes are high.

Gameplay / Cool Mechanics

The text is simple: “Look at the top 3 cards of your Main Deck. Put 1 into your hand and recycle the rest.”

That “recycle” isn’t just aesthetic—it means those two other cards go back into circulation without clogging your draws.

The keyword “Action” means you can play it during your turn or in a showdown, so whether you’re digging for removal, a finisher, or just smoothing out a risky board state, Stacked Deck gives you options.

This isn’t just a cantrip. It’s a miniature sculptor. Control builds, combo cores, tempo decks—they all love this kind of tool.

The fact that it’s only 1 mana makes it practically frictionless in lists that run lean on curve.

Pull Rate & Value Speculation

Stacked Deck is card 183/298, and it’s probably a rare or uncommon depending on how powerful card filtering ends up in Riftbound’s economy.

It’s one of those staples that feels modest on paper but becomes essential across metas.

If it drops in foil, expect it to be a quiet hit with competitive grinders and aesthetic collectors alike—especially if the card back or tokens echo that gold-and-purple colorway.

An overnumbered version with a transparent card overlay or casino-themed alt art? Instant collectible.
